/* CSS Document */
.indexby {background:url(../image/ht_02.jpg) repeat-x top; }
body { background:url(../image/fy.jpg) repeat-x top;font-family:"宋体"; color:#333333; font-size:12px; line-height:24px;}
a { color:#333333; text-decoration:none;}
li { list-style:none;}
img { border:0;}
* { padding:0; margin:0;}
.content { margin:0 auto; width:980px;}
.qc { clear:both; line-height:0; font-size:0; height:0;}
.top {}
.topr { float:right; padding-top:35px; line-height:35px;}

.nav { background:url(../image/h_r5_c6.jpg) repeat-x; height:32px;}
.nav ul { float:left;}
.nav ul li { float:left; display:block; width:110px; line-height:32px; text-align:center; background:url(../image/h_r5_c23.jpg) no-repeat left top; font-weight:bold }
.nav1 { background:url(../image/h_r5_c1.jpg) no-repeat; width:8px; height:32px; float:left;}
.nav2 { background:url(../image/h_r5_c30.jpg) no-repeat; width:7px; float:right; height:32px;}

.left { width:320px; float:left; margin-top:25px;}
.lefttab {
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#dedede;
}
.min { width:335px; float:left; margin-left:25px; margin-top:25px;}
.mintab {	border-bottom-width: 1px;border-bottom-style: solid;border-bottom-color: #dedede; background:url(../image/h_r8_c12.jpg) no-repeat left; height:23px; text-indent:1em; }
.mintab span { float:right; padding-top:10px;}
.about { margin-top:10px; background:url(../image/h_r13_c18.jpg) no-repeat bottom; padding-bottom:130px;}
.rig { width:285px; float:right; margin-top:25px;}
.lx { margin-top:10px;}
.lx ul li {
	background:url(../image/h_r16_c21.jpg) no-repeat left;
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-bottom-color: #dedede; text-indent:1em;
}
.footbg { background:url(../image/foot.jpg) repeat-x;}
.foot { width:980px; margin:auto;}
.minnav { background:url(../image/h_r20_c9.jpg) repeat-x; height:37px; text-align:center;}
.minnav1 { background:url(../image/h_r20_c2.jpg) no-repeat top; width:20px; float:left; height:37px;}
.minnav a { color:#FFFFFF; margin-left:5px; margin-right:5px;}
.navmain { float:left; width:880px; height:37px; padding-top:5px;}
.minnav2 { background:url(../image/h_r20_c28.jpg) no-repeat top; width:48px; float:right; height:37px;}
.footmain { text-align:center; margin-top:5px; padding-bottom:10px;}


.TabTitle{
	clear:both;

	}
.TabTitle li{ 
    float:left; 
	display:inline; 
	width:81px; 
	cursor:pointer; 
	line-height:23px; 
	text-align:center; 
	font-weight:bold;
	margin-right:7px;}
.active{
    background:url(../image/h_r8_c3.jpg) no-repeat; height:23px; width:77px;
    color:#333333;
	display: block;
}
.TabTitle a { color:#333333;}
.normal{ 
    height:23px;
	background:url(../image/h_r8_c12.jpg) no-repeat; 
    display:block;
    color:#333333;
	}
.TabContent{text-align:left; clear:both;  }


.st1 { 
    float:left; 
	display:inline; 
 }

.news1{ 
    margin-top:10px;
	}
.news1 ul {
    list-style:none;
	margin-top:10px;
	}
.news1 ul li {
	width:100%;
	height:30px;
	line-height:30px;
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-bottom-color: #999999;
	padding-left:10px;
}
.news1 ul li a{background:url(../image/h_r16_c21.jpg) no-repeat 0 4px; text-indent:20px;}


.news1 ul li span { 
    display:block;  
	float:right;
	margin-right:10px;
	}
.news1 img{
    float:left;
	}
.news2 img{
    float:left;
	}
.none { display:none;}
.new0{
    width:340px;
	float:right;
	line-height:24px;
	}
.new0 h1{
   font-size:12px;
   }
.news2{ 
     margin-top:10px;
	 }
.news2 ul {
     list-style:none;
	 margin-top:10px;
	 }
.news2 ul li { 
	width:100%;
	line-height:30px;
	padding-left:10px;
	background-repeat:no-repeat;
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-bottom-color: #999999;}

.news2 ul li a{background:url(../image/h_r16_c21.jpg) no-repeat 0 4px;}


.news2 ul li span { 
     display:block; 
	 float:right;
	 margin-right:10px;
}



.pro{ width:980px; height:220px;margin:0 auto; padding-top:25px; background:url(../image/pro_li.jpg) no-repeat top;}

/*产品滚动样式*/
.img-scroll { margin:0px auto; width:975px;position:relative; margin-left:5px; }
.nextpic_t{ width: 141px;font-size:12px;color: #666666;font-weight: bold;line-height: 26px; }
.nextpic_t span{font: 12px/normal Arial,Helvetica,Verdana,Sans-serif;color: #fe9900;font-size: 12px;font-weight: normal;}
.img-scroll .prev,.img-scroll .next {width:14px; height:26px; color:#FFF; text-align:center;  cursor:pointer; position:absolute; display:block;top:60px;}
.img-scroll .prev {float:left;left:-10px;}
.img-scroll .next {float:right;right:10px; _right:0px;}
.nextpic_c{padding:5px;}

.img-list {  width:920px; overflow:hidden;position:relative; margin:0 auto;}
.img-list ul { margin:0;padding:0;width:9999px;overflow: hidden;}
.img-list li { float:left; margin-right:13px; width:173px; height:auto; text-align:center; display:inline;}
.img-list li img{ background:#fff; margin:0 auto;  border:4px solid #dcccad; display:block;}
.img-list li A:hover img {border:4px solid #c4b79a;}
.img-list li p{width:173px;height:47px;line-height:47px;overflow: hidden; background:url(../image/li.jpg) no-repeat;}